More things you really don't need to know... On Thursday, the results of the Gallup Healthways Well-being Index were released, giving insight into what states are the happiest – and which states are the saddest. Perhaps it shouldn’t come as a surprise that a state perhaps best known for sun and surf snagged the top spot on the list (think: volcanoes and leis), but there are some upsets in the mix (are New Yorkers REALLY happier than people from Indiana?). http://www.weather.com/health/happiest-saddest-state-20130301

if you don't like where you live, then move...if you like where you live, then don't move...this poll does nothing for me...
I live in Louisiana, one of the greatest states, in my humble opinion. We have history in the French Quarter, Antebellum homes, civil war sites, indian mounds, some of the best restaurants in the world, great local music, Tabasco is made here. For the outdoor enthusiasts, we have mild winter weather that is ideal for winter hunting and fishing, we have a 40 mile converted railroad line that is used for running, cycling, and horseback riding, sports are played year round, we have professional football and basketball, numberous minor league baseball teams, and even roller derby is making a comeback!
We also have some negatives, a political system that still has too much corruption, many schools fall into the sub-par performance category, and lest we forget - a risk of devastation annually due to hurricanes.
Are there other places in the country I'd like to live? Sure, if money was no object, i'd be living on Central Park West in the Dakota! With a summer home in Key West, a winer home in Aspen, and a vacation home in California.
But in the end - there is no place like home!
